大数据分析学什么技术
-
大数据分析涉及多种技术和工具,包括但不限于以下几点:
-
数据存储和管理技术:大数据分析需要处理庞大的数据量,因此数据存储和管理技术是至关重要的。常用的技术包括关系型数据库(如MySQL、PostgreSQL)、NoSQL数据库(如MongoDB、Cassandra)、以及分布式文件系统(如Hadoop HDFS、Amazon S3)等。
-
数据清洗和预处理技术:大数据往往包含大量的噪音和无效数据,因此在进行分析之前需要对数据进行清洗和预处理。常用的技术包括数据清洗工具(如OpenRefine、Trifacta Wrangler)、数据转换工具(如Apache Spark、Pandas)等。
-
数据分析和挖掘技术:数据分析和挖掘是大数据分析的核心环节,通过这些技术可以从数据中提取有用的信息和知识。常用的技术包括数据可视化工具(如Tableau、Power BI)、机器学习算法(如回归分析、聚类分析)、数据挖掘工具(如Weka、RapidMiner)等。
-
分布式计算技术:由于大数据量的特点,传统的单机计算无法满足需求,因此需要借助分布式计算技术。常用的技术包括MapReduce框架(如Apache Hadoop、Apache Spark)、分布式计算引擎(如Apache Flink、Apache Storm)等。
-
实时数据处理技术:随着数据量的不断增加,对实时数据处理的需求也日益增加。常用的技术包括流处理技术(如Apache Kafka、Apache Flink)、实时数据库(如Redis、MongoDB)等。
总的来说,大数据分析涉及的技术非常广泛,需要掌握多种技术和工具才能进行有效的数据分析和挖掘工作。同时,随着技术的不断发展,大数据分析领域也在不断演进,需要保持学习和更新技能才能跟上行业的发展趋势。
1年前 -
-
学习大数据分析涉及多种技术和工具,以下是大数据分析中常见的技术和工具:
-
数据挖掘和机器学习:数据挖掘和机器学习是大数据分析中的核心技术。数据挖掘是从大型数据集中发现模式和知识的过程,而机器学习是让计算机系统通过数据学习并改进性能的技术。
-
数据处理和存储技术:大数据分析需要处理海量数据,因此数据处理和存储技术至关重要。Hadoop、Spark和Flink等大数据处理框架可以帮助处理大规模数据,而HDFS、HBase、Cassandra等存储系统则可以有效地存储大数据。
-
数据可视化:数据可视化是将数据转换为图形化形式的过程,可以帮助人们更直观地理解数据。学习数据可视化技术可以帮助分析师更好地向他人展示数据分析结果,Tableau、Power BI和D3.js等工具都是常见的数据可视化工具。
-
数据清洗和预处理:在进行大数据分析之前,通常需要对数据进行清洗和预处理,以确保数据质量。学习数据清洗和预处理技术可以帮助分析师在分析之前处理原始数据,提高数据分析的准确性和可信度。
-
数据库和SQL:掌握数据库和SQL技术对于大数据分析也是至关重要的。无论是传统的关系型数据库还是新型的NoSQL数据库,都是大数据分析中常用的数据存储和查询工具。
-
编程语言:掌握一门或多门编程语言也是大数据分析中必不可少的技能。Python、R和Java等编程语言在大数据分析中应用广泛,可以帮助分析师进行数据处理、建模和可视化等工作。
总之,学习大数据分析需要掌握数据挖掘和机器学习、数据处理和存储技术、数据可视化、数据清洗和预处理、数据库和SQL、以及编程语言等多种技术和工具。这些技术和工具相互配合,能够帮助分析师更好地处理和分析大数据,从中发现有价值的信息和洞察。
1年前 -
-
标题:学习大数据分析需要掌握的关键技术
在今天的数字化时代,大数据分析已经成为许多行业的重要工具,帮助企业从海量数据中提取有价值的信息,进行决策和优化。要成为一名优秀的大数据分析师,需要掌握一系列关键技术。本文将从数据收集、数据处理、数据分析和数据可视化等方面介绍学习大数据分析所需的关键技术。
1. 数据收集技术
1.1 网络爬虫技术
网络爬虫是一种自动化程序,可以从互联网上抓取信息。学习如何使用网络爬虫工具,如Scrapy、BeautifulSoup等,可以帮助你从各种网站上收集数据。
1.2 数据库技术
了解数据库的基本原理和SQL语言是大数据分析的基础。掌握关系型数据库(如MySQL、PostgreSQL)和NoSQL数据库(如MongoDB、Redis)的使用方法,可以帮助你存储和管理大量数据。
2. 数据处理技术
2.1 数据清洗技术
数据清洗是指对数据中的错误、缺失和重复值进行处理,保证数据质量。学习使用Python中的Pandas库和NumPy库可以帮助你进行数据清洗和数据转换操作。
2.2 数据转换技术
数据转换是将原始数据转换为可以用于分析的形式。学习使用ETL工具(如Apache NiFi、Talend)可以帮助你将不同格式和来源的数据整合在一起。
3. 数据分析技术
3.1 机器学习技术
机器学习是一种人工智能技术,可以帮助分析师从数据中发现模式和趋势。学习使用Python中的Scikit-learn库和TensorFlow库可以帮助你应用机器学习算法进行数据分析。
3.2 数据挖掘技术
数据挖掘是一种发现隐藏在数据中的规律和关联的技术。学习使用数据挖掘工具(如Weka、RapidMiner)可以帮助你挖掘数据中的潜在信息。
4. 数据可视化技术
4.1 数据可视化工具
数据可视化是将数据以图表、图形等形式展示出来,帮助人们更直观地理解数据。学习使用数据可视化工具(如Tableau、Power BI)可以帮助你将分析结果呈现给他人。
4.2 数据故事讲述技术
数据故事讲述是将数据分析结果以故事的形式呈现,使得数据更具说服力和吸引力。学习如何编写数据故事和制作数据可视化报告可以提升你的沟通能力。
总结来说,学习大数据分析需要掌握数据收集、数据处理、数据分析和数据可视化等关键技术。通过不断学习和实践,你可以成为一名优秀的大数据分析师,为企业提供有价值的数据支持。
1年前


